LOS ANGELES - Californer -- Today was released the remix version of "Sigo Inédito", a 'corrido tumbado' that unites the different styles and cultures of GUSTAVO PALAFOX, BRRAY, GRUPO SIGMA and FUEGO.
The remix version of "Sigo Inédito" is a mixture of the 'sierreño' and urban genres, which highlights the unique style of each artist without losing their individual essences. In addition to Gustavo Palafox and the Puerto Rican Brray, who participated in the original recording, now the remix version includes the valuable collaborations of Grupo Sigma, a trio of three young exponents of Regional Mexican, born in Caborca, Sonora; and Fuego, a big star of the Latin Urban genre and of Dominican-American origin.
"Sigo Inédito" relates the story of a Mexican who does business with a person of Puerto Rican nationality. Additionally, the title of this 'corrido tumbado' expresses with pride that the artist Gustavo Palafox continues to be unpublished to this moment, since all of the official recordings of the young singer-songwriter have been written by himself. About this new version Gustavo commented, "My people, I am super excited about the result of this collaboration. Through the remix of "Sigo inédito" we are continuing to expand our music."

Brray on his part expresses, "I love the 'corrido' and I liked this one because it talks about the connection between Mexico and Puerto Rico, so we immediately jumped on this one. I felt very comfortable recording it and I really liked how my voice came out in it, and I even said that I could comfortably go into this."
Fuego, who was added to this 'corrido' says, "I like mixing my style with different genres and uniting Latin cultures;" and Grupo Sigma also declares, "We are happy to be part of this collaboration between friends and colleagues, including Regional Mexican with Urban, because music does not have limits!"
The sound of this great "Regional Urban" collaboration was accomplished thanks to the production of Jorge Tapia (member of Grupo Sigma), Gustavo Palafox and Alberto de León (Two-time Latin Grammy nominee).
